Step 1: Choose Your Main Ingredients
Chicken soup starts with chicken and broth. For the chicken, opt for bone-in, skin-on chicken thighs or a whole cut-up chicken. The bones and skin add flavor, collagen, and body to the broth as it simmers. Using a mix of white and dark meat gives you tender, juicy pieces of chicken in the finished soup.
For the broth you can use water, but chicken or vegetable broth lends more flavor. Low-sodium broth lets the flavors of the other ingredients shine. Canned or boxed broth offers convenience, or you can make your own to control the salt level.
Step 2: Prep Your Aromatics
The veggies known as aromatics—onion, celery, carrot—build a flavor base for chicken soup. Dice the onion and mince the garlic. Slice the celery and carrot thinly on the bias. The long, thin slices will melt into the broth. You can stick to this classic trio or add other veggies you enjoy like potatoes, spinach, or green beans.
Step 3: Brown the Chicken
Browning the chicken before simmering it transforms the flavor of the soup. Pat the chicken dry and season all over with salt and pepper. Heat oil in a large pot over medium-high heat. Working in batches, add the chicken skin-side down and cook undisturbed until golden brown, about 5 minutes per side. Remove and set aside.
Step 4: Simmer the Broth
Return the browned chicken to the pot along with the broth, aromatics, and any other veggies. Add herbs like bay leaves, parsley, thyme, or oregano. Bring to a boil then reduce heat and simmer until the chicken is very tender, about 45 minutes. Skim off any foam that rises to the top.
Step 5: Shred the Chicken
Once cooled, remove the chicken from the bones and shred or chop into bite-size pieces. Discard the skin and bones. The collagen from the bones has enriched the broth while cooking.
Step 6: Finish the Soup
Return the shredded chicken to the pot. Simmer a few minutes more to heat through. Taste and adjust seasoning as desired. You can add noodles, rice, or other mix-ins in the last 5 minutes of simmering so they’re perfectly cooked. Ladle into bowls and garnish with fresh herbs. Enjoy!
Tips for Maximizing Flavor
-
Sear the chicken – Browning the chicken builds incredible flavor. Be sure to let the pieces cook undisturbed so they properly brown.
-
Simmer the bones – Chicken bones impart collagen, gelatin, and minerals that give the broth body and richness.
-
Sauté the aromatics – Cook the onion, celery, carrot, and garlic briefly before adding liquid. This deepens their flavor.
-
Use fresh herbs – Herbs like parsley, thyme, oregano, and bay leaf infuse the broth with aroma and taste.
-
Add acid – A splash of lemon juice or vinegar at the end brightens the flavors.
-
Season thoughtfully – Taste and adjust salt, pepper, and herbs until the flavors pop.
Storage Tips for Leftover Chicken Soup
-
Store in an airtight container in the fridge up to 4 days.
-
Freeze in airtight containers or freezer bags up to 4 months.
-
Portion into single servings before freezing for easy reheating.
-
Cool soup completely before refrigerating or freezing to prevent moisture loss.
-
Reheat gently on the stovetop or microwave until warmed through.
Fun Ways to Customize Your Chicken Soup
One of the joys of homemade chicken soup is how versatile it is. Try these fun add-ins:
-
Noodles – Egg noodles, pasta shells, orzo, ramen noodles
-
Rice – White or brown rice, wild rice, riced cauliflower
-
Veggies – Spinach, kale, potatoes, zucchini, peas, corn
-
Beans – White beans, chickpeas, lentils, black beans
-
Meat – Shredded rotisserie chicken, sausage, beef
-
Dumplings – Light and fluffy homemade dumplings
-
Tortellini – Cheese-filled or meat tortellini
-
Spices – Chili powder, cumin, smoked paprika, turmeric
With a little creativity, you can reinvent chicken soup in endless comforting, nourishing ways. Master this easy homemade chicken soup recipe, then start experimenting to create your signature version.
